When using shad for bottom fishing, be sure to cut the bait’s tail before baiting your hook. This keeps the baited fish from spinning and winding around your fishing line as it sinks to the bottom, helping you prevent a tangled line. Fish will be more attracted to the scent of the cut bait.

Many bass fishermen choose to fish with lighter-colored grubs. Grubs that have a predominantly white, chartreuse or yellow in color are some of the most effective at attracting bass. Grubs with translucent bodies often have metallic flecks that reflect light and increase your chances of success. If you don’t seem to be able to catch anything, use a water-colored grub.

Never panic if you have managed to hook a big fish. Protect your rod from a fight by not reeling the fish in immediately. First you need to set the drag, then patiently wait for fatigue to set in on the fish, after that you slowly reel the fish in.

If you use Shad as bait for bottom-feeding fish, cut the tails off before putting the fish on your hook. When you do this, the shad won’t spin as you lower it to the bottom. This will keep your line from getting tangled. Fish will be more attracted to the scent of the cut bait.

When you fish in a stream always cast upstream so the current will carry your lure to your fishing hole. This gives a much more natural appearance and will greatly increase your chances of getting a bite. Try to always keep your line taught, and reduce the slack in your line so you can feel the fish bite.
